Comprehending the Role of a Demolition Professional
Although demolition could appear uncomplicated, recognizing the role of a demolition service provider discloses an intricate blend of expertise, security protocols, and job administration. These specialists are in charge of assessing frameworks and establishing the very best methods for dismantling them while minimizing threats to people and the atmosphere. Their expertise encompasses different aspects, including neighborhood regulations, environmental factors to consider, and the proper disposal of hazardous materials.Demolition contractors coordinate with engineers, designers, and local authorities to assure compliance with security requirements and legal demands (muck away). They conduct complete website examinations, identifying any kind of potential hazards before starting work. Their project management skills are essential in organizing, resource allowance, and ensuring that tasks are finished in a timely manner and within spending plan. By supervising the whole demolition process, from preparing to execution, these professionals play an essential function in transforming spaces safely and efficiently, laying the groundwork for future construction

Ecological Considerations in Demolition
Ecological factors to consider play a vital function in demolition projects, especially in waste management approaches and the handling of hazardous materials. Efficient waste administration not only decreases garbage dump effect yet additionally advertises recycling and reuse of products. In addition, proper handling of unsafe compounds assurances compliance with safeguards and policies both public health and wellness and the setting.
Waste Administration Approaches
While the demolition procedure typically produces considerable waste, efficient waste monitoring strategies can advertise and minimize ecological effects sustainability. Demolition service providers apply numerous methods to manage particles responsibly, guaranteeing products are reused or recycled whenever feasible. Salvaging beneficial elements, such as steels, wood, and bricks, minimizes landfill contributions and saves all-natural resources.Contractors often function carefully with waste monitoring centers to kind and process products successfully, maximizing recycling prices. In addition, they may take on practices like deconstruction, which involves taking down frameworks item by piece, allowing for higher recuperation of multiple-use products. By prioritizing sustainable waste administration strategies, demolition professionals assist minimize environmental impacts and contribute to a round economic situation, highlighting the significance of liable resource monitoring in building and construction and demolition activities.
Dangerous Product Handling
Hazardous materials existing substantial obstacles throughout the demolition procedure, needing meticulous dealing with to protect both employees and the atmosphere. Demolition professionals have to straight from the source recognize and take care of compounds like asbestos, lead, and chemicals that can present health risks. This involves carrying out thorough website assessments to locate these materials before any kind of demolition begins. Appropriate training and certification are important for workers, ensuring they understand risk-free removal and disposal procedures. Additionally, contractors should abide by neighborhood and government guidelines regarding contaminated materials to reduce environmental effect. Making use of specific equipment and techniques, they can properly include and safely eliminate harmful materials. Eventually, efficient harmful material handling is essential to maintaining safety criteria and protecting surrounding areas during demolition jobs.

Price Variables and Budgeting for Demolition Projects
Cost factors to consider play an essential duty in intending a demolition project. A number of factors affect the total spending plan, including project size, area, and complexity. The sort of framework being knocked down, whether domestic, industrial, or commercial, can substantially influence prices because of differing regulations and required authorizations. Furthermore, the visibility of dangerous materials, such as asbestos or lead, necessitates specialized handling, which can increase expenses.Labor costs also stand for a considerable part of the budget, as experienced workers and machinery are needed to guarantee safety and efficiency. Site preparation, waste disposal, and environmental factors to consider additionally add to the total expenditure.To handle expenses efficiently, task her response proprietors must acquire multiple quotes from demolition specialists, contrasting solutions offered and prices frameworks. Establishing a clear spending plan while representing prospective backups is vital, as unforeseen obstacles can develop during demolition. Proper preparation guarantees that the job remains economically feasible official statement and effective.
